A Certificate Programme in Tree Propagation provides comprehensive training in the art and science of cultivating trees from seeds, cuttings, and other propagation methods. Participants gain practical, hands-on experience in nursery management and develop a strong understanding of plant physiology crucial for successful tree propagation.
Learning outcomes include mastering various propagation techniques, such as grafting, budding, and air layering. Students will also gain proficiency in plant health management, including pest and disease control, crucial for maintaining healthy tree stock. The curriculum covers crucial aspects of horticulture, including soil science and irrigation techniques.
The programme duration typically ranges from several weeks to a few months, depending on the institution and the intensity of the course. The flexible learning structure often accommodates both full-time and part-time students, catering to various learning styles and schedules. Many courses offer a mix of theoretical lectures and practical fieldwork.
